Real cool band yeah British Sea Power will play an ex-secret show in London this time next week.
The act, whose new album Do You Like Rock Music is due for release on the 14th of January (click), will play at the recently re-opened Amersham Arms on Wednesday 21st November.
New material from …Rock Music will be previewed at the gig, with support for the night coming from John & Jehn and Roaring Twenties. Tickets will set you back a tenner, or £7 with the presentation of an NUS/Amersham Regulars cards.
